While Home Depot primarily focuses on tools, materials, and home improvement supplies, many locations include clean, well-maintained restrooms for customer use. These facilities are typically located near entrances and designed for convenience, offering basic amenities like sinks, hand dryers, and accessible stalls. However, dedicated bathrooms labeled exclusively as 'Home Depot restrooms' are rare; instead, they serve as public facilities during business hours.

To find restrooms, simply look for signage with restroom symbols near store entrances or inside common areas. Inside, restrooms are usually unmarked but clearly identifiable with standard signage. Some larger stores may have family restrooms or ADA-compliant facilities—ideal for extended visits. Always check the store’s online directory or app for real-time updates on facility availability.
